>일반적인 문제 >보수연산의 특징은 무엇인가?

보수연산의 특징은 무엇인가?

百草
百草원래의
2023-12-29 14:20:251220검색

보수 연산의 특징: 1. 부호 비트와 숫자 비트의 통합 처리 2. 단순화된 산술 단위 구조 3. 오버플로 감지의 편리한 구현 4. 단순화된 곱셈 및 나눗셈 연산 6. 편리함 이진수 덧셈 및 뺄셈 연산 구현 7. 강력한 간섭 방지 기능 8. 원본 코드 및 역코드에 비해 확실한 이점. 자세한 소개: 1. 부호 비트와 숫자 비트는 균일하게 처리되고 보수 표현이 사용됩니다. 부호 비트와 기타 비트는 균일하게 처리될 수 있으므로 덧셈과 뺄셈 연산이 동일한 알고리즘을 사용할 수 있습니다. 유닛 구조 등

보수연산의 특징은 무엇인가?

보수 연산의 특징은 주로 다음과 같은 측면을 포함합니다.

1. 부호 비트와 숫자 비트의 통합 처리: 보수 표현을 사용하면 부호 비트와 기타 비트를 균일하게 처리할 수 있습니다. 동일한 알고리즘을 뺄셈에 사용할 수 있습니다. 이는 산술 규칙을 단순화하고 컴퓨터의 덧셈기가 동시에 덧셈과 뺄셈 연산을 완료할 수 있게 해줍니다.

2. 단순화된 산술 단위 구조: 보수 표현은 부호 비트와 숫자 비트를 균일하게 처리할 수 있으므로 별도의 세트를 설계할 필요 없이 산술 단위에서 덧셈 회로를 직접 사용하여 덧셈 및 뺄셈 연산을 완료할 수 있습니다. 뺄셈용. 이는 컴퓨터의 연산장치 내부 구조를 대폭 단순화하고 하드웨어의 복잡성과 비용을 줄여준다.

3. 편리한 오버플로 감지 구현: 보수 표현에서 가장 높은 비트(부호 비트)는 부호를 나타내고 나머지 비트는 값 자체를 나타냅니다. 덧셈 연산이 오버플로되면 부호 비트는 오버플로를 감지하는 데 사용할 수 있는 캐리를 생성합니다. 이 오버플로 감지 메커니즘에는 추가 회로나 명령이 필요하지 않으므로 2의 보수 표현이 더 효율적입니다.

4. 곱셈과 나눗셈 연산 단순화: 보수 표현에서는 일련의 덧셈과 뺄셈을 통해 곱셈과 나눗셈 연산을 구현할 수 있습니다. 이는 곱셈과 나눗셈 연산의 회로 설계를 단순화하여 컴퓨터가 곱셈과 나눗셈 연산을 더 빠르게 완료할 수 있게 해줍니다.

5. 연산 결과는 고유합니다. 보수 표현에서는 주어진 값에 대해 보수 형식이 고유합니다. 이를 통해 2의 보수 계산의 모호성을 방지하고 계산 결과를 더욱 정확하고 신뢰할 수 있게 만듭니다.

6. 이진수의 덧셈 및 뺄셈 연산 구현을 촉진합니다. 보수 표현에서는 덧셈 연산을 사용하여 이진수의 덧셈 및 뺄셈 연산을 균일하게 구현할 수 있습니다. 이는 이진수의 덧셈과 뺄셈 과정을 단순화하고 연산 효율성을 향상시킵니다.

7. 강력한 간섭 방지 능력: 보수 표현은 음수와 양수를 나타낼 수 있으므로 신호 전송 중에 강력한 간섭 방지 능력을 갖습니다. 전송 중 잡음 간섭이 발생하더라도 보수의 부호비트를 검출하면 원본 데이터를 복구할 수 있다.

8. 원본 코드와 역코드에 비해 분명한 장점이 있습니다. 원 코드와 역코드도 정수를 나타낼 수 있지만 실제 적용에는 몇 가지 제한 사항과 결함이 있습니다. 예를 들어, 덧셈과 뺄셈 연산을 수행할 때 원본 코드와 보완 코드를 변환해야 하는 반면, 보완 코드는 덧셈과 뺄셈 연산을 직접 수행할 수 있으며, 음수를 표현할 때 보완 코드가 더 직관적이고 이해하기 쉽습니다. , 정확도가 더 높습니다. 따라서 현대 컴퓨터 시스템에서는 보수 표현이 부호 있는 정수의 표현으로 가장 널리 사용됩니다.

요약하자면, 보수연산은 많은 장점을 가지고 있어 컴퓨터 과학에서 널리 사용됩니다. 보수 표현을 사용함으로써 컴퓨터는 수치 계산을 보다 효율적으로 수행하고, 산술 단위의 설계를 단순화하며, 연산 속도와 정확성을 향상시킬 수 있습니다.

위 내용은 보수연산의 특징은 무엇인가?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.